HB 556 Restoration of civil right to vote; felon eligible to vote upon completion of sentence.

Introduced by: Betsy B. Carr | all patrons    ...    notes | add to my profiles

S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:

Restoration of civil rights. Provides for the automatic restoration of a felon's civil right to be eligible to vote upon the completion of his sentence, including any term of probation or parole, and the payment of all restitution, fines, costs, and fees assessed as a result of the felony conviction. The bill has a contingent effective date of January 1, 2017, provided that the voters approve an amendment to Section 1 of Article II of the Constitution of Virginia at the 2015 November election.
